检查网络、权限、配置文件
获取配置失败可能由多种原因导致,以下是常见的原因及对应的解决方案:
一、网络连接问题
-
检查网络连通性
-
使用
ping
或traceroute
测试与配置服务器的连接。 -
重启路由器或调整网络设置(如VLAN配置)。
-
-
防火墙与安全策略
-
确认服务器端口开放且防火墙允许通信。
-
检查安全组规则或访问控制列表(ACL)。
-
二、配置文件错误
-
文件完整性检查
-
确认配置文件未损坏或路径正确。
-
尝试备份配置文件并恢复。
-
-
格式与权限
-
检查配置文件格式(如语法错误、参数拼写错误)。
-
确认配置文件权限允许当前用户读取(如
chmod 644
)。
-
三、服务器端问题
-
服务状态与权限
-
检查配置服务器是否运行正常(如
systemctl status
)。 -
确认用户具有访问配置文件的权限。
-
-
软件兼容性
- 更新服务器软件至最新版本,避免因版本不兼容导致错误。
四、客户端请求问题
-
参数与协议
-
检查请求参数是否完整且格式正确。
-
确认使用正确的请求协议(如GET/POST)及地址。
-
-
环境配置差异
- 核对开发/测试/生产环境的配置是否一致。
五、其他可能原因
-
临时解决方案 :关闭防火墙或添加例外规则。
-
重置密钥 :在阿里云等平台尝试重置AppSecret。
-
联系技术支持 :若以上方法无效,提供错误日志获取进一步帮助。
排查步骤建议 :
- 优先检查网络连接和配置文件。2. 若涉及数据库配置,验证数据库服务状态及权限。3. 逐步排查服务器端进程、系统日志及客户端请求细节。通过以上步骤,多数获取配置失败的问题可得到解决。